What is SeatGuru?
A Brief Overview
SeatGuru is a travel website that provides seat maps, reviews, and in-flight information for various airlines. It helps travelers choose the best seats before booking a ticket or during check-in.
How It Works
By searching for your airline and flight number, SeatGuru shows the aircraft layout, highlighting the best and worst seats with color codes and notes.
Why It’s Popular
Frequent flyers rely on it for accurate seat recommendations, helping them avoid cramped legroom, limited recline, or noisy areas near the galley and lavatories.
Key Features of SeatGuru
Detailed Seat Maps
SeatGuru offers comprehensive seat maps with color-coded ratings, so you can quickly identify which seats are worth booking.
In-Flight Amenities Guide
The platform lists entertainment options, power outlets, and Wi-Fi availability, making it easier to plan your flight activities.
Quick Seat Comparison
With side-by-side comparisons, you can see how seats differ in pitch, width, and amenities.

How to Use SeatGuru Effectively
Step 1: Search Your Flight
Enter your airline, flight number, and date to access your aircraft’s specific seat map.
Step 2: Read Seat Notes
Respond to warnings about restricted recline, proximity to restrooms, or missing windows.
Step 3: Compare Before Booking
Use the information to decide if paying for a premium seat is worth it.

Alternatives to SeatGuru
Airline Websites
Some airlines offer their interactive seat maps, though they may lack passenger reviews.
ExpertFlyer
A premium tool providing detailed seat availability and upgrade alerts.
TripAdvisor Flight Reviews
Since SeatGuru is part of TripAdvisor, you can also browse traveler opinions directly on the platform.
